As I have done in the past I will be posting calculations for how the Stay Play Dine deal works.
This year it seems VERY simple but I will continue to validate:
If you want to price your own click here and then click learn more and click on the SPD discount packages: https://disneyrewards.com/offers/wdwq2roomsepfy16/
VALUE RESORTS:
2017 Discount = 40% OFF DINING
There is no discount on tickets or room
For Comparison sake:
2015 was 55% off dining plus a small room discount
2016 was 40% off dining plus a VERY small room discount ($1.75 off per night we believe)
(FYI There was never a discount on tickets on this promo)
MODERATE RESORTS:
2017 Discount = 45% OFF DINING
There is no discount on tickets or room
For Comparison sake:
2015 was 55% off dining plus a small room discount
2016 was 55% off dining for the first adult plus 45% off dining for each additional person (adult or child) plus a VERY small room discount ($1.00 off per night we believe)
(FYI There was never a discount on tickets on this promo)
DELUXE RESORTS:
Appears to be 45% OFF DINING
with no discount on tickets or room
(still working on more details here)
THERE IS AN INSTANCE OF A DELUXE VILLA GETTING MUCH BETTER THAN 45% DISCOUNT - see post further down on page 1
Prior years for Deluxe resorts was the same as moderate except the room discount portion may have been slightly larger than moderate.

Here is an example of the SPD deal in 2016 vs. 2017. Our example family is 2 adults, a child age 7 and a child age 1 (free). They are staying 6 nights in a standard room at CBR at the end of Jan/early Feb with 7 day base tickets and the regular Disney dining plan.
In 2015 under the SPD deal they would have paid (all approximate):
Rom: $1,057
Tickets: $1,014
Dining: $376
TOTAL: $2,447
In 2016 under the SPD deal they would have paid (all approximate):
Room: $1,122
Tickets: $1,049
Dining: $458
TOTAL: $2,629
In 2017 under the SPD deal they will pay (all approximate):
Room: $1,151
Tickets: $1,161
Dining: $524
TOTAL: $2,836
So with the price increases on rooms, tickets & dining, combined with the lesser discount amounts...the example family pays $182 more in 2016 (vs. '15) and $207 more in 2017 (vs. '16). Over 2 years the same discounted package goes up $389 which is approximately an 8% increase annually.
